[QUOTE="Siteworx, post: 99943, member: 13680"] Hey guys! I need some help from the experts. I have a 2000 model 873 with 2600 hrs on it. It was serviced about 90 hrs ago and and has been running great. I bought the machine with 2500 hrs on it and was not sure what the timing belt looked like so I had it replaced too. It actually looked pretty new when we pulled it out so it had been replaced. In the last month the engine has started running rough at times. When this happens it loses power and starts smoking. It is black smoke and sounds like it is hitting on 3 cylinders. I can stop the machine and let it run for a minute and it will clear up. Some days it will never do this.. I am very concerned and looking for help. I have checked the air filter but it is clean. I checked the fuel by draining the filter and no water or trash that I can see. What kills me is that it is not happening all the time. Please help me out if you have any idea. I run off-road diesel in all my equipment so I don't think it is water in the fuel. Thanks Mike [/QUOTE]
